Often times it’s possible to recover deleted data off of a hard drive, but the same is not as true when it comes to your systems RAM. You can even use to store sensitive information that you will want wiped clean after a system reboot.
If you use large databases that normally take a long time to load or update you could move the database to the partition temporarily while you work with it to gain the benefits of your system memory. Setting your system and applications to store its temp files in the RAMDisk partition will also go a long way for speeding up installations and load time. For instance by setting your internet browsers cache to store in the RAMDisk partition your internet browsing speed should see a noticeable increase in speed. If you’re wondering what use would you would have with a small partition size of just a few gigabytes or less I’ll be glad to help toss some ideas your way.īecause your system memory is wiped every time you reboot the machine you’ll want to focus your newly acquired disk space on files that will be mostly temporary. RAMDisk provides a way to use a set portion of your systems memory for file usage, significantly increasing the read and write speeds of whatever you use within the RAMDisk partition. Because the memory in your computer has no moving parts to generate noise and heat it runs a much faster speed than traditional hard drives.
